Facts About Lyndhurst
Lyndhurst is a small town in the New
Forest, Hampshire, England. It is often called the "Capital
of the New Forest" and is a popular tourist location with
many shops, cafés, pubs and hotels.
Lyndhurst is also home to the New Forest
Museum. The nearest city is Southampton located around nine
miles (14 km) to the north-east. In 2001 Lyndhurst had a
population of 2,973 people.
Alice Liddell, also known as Alice
Hargreaves, the inspiration for Alice in Lewis Carroll's
Alice's Adventures in Wonderland, lived in and around
Lyndhurst after her marriage to Reginald Hargreaves, and is
buried in the graveyard of the church of St. Michael &
All Angels, Lyndhurst.
Other major landmarks include Bolton's
Bench, a picturesque hill to the east of the village; and a
row of much photographed thatched cottages on the road to
the neighbouring hamlet of Emery Down.
The village is the administrative capital
of the New Forest, with the district council based in the
village.
The Court of Verderers sits in the Queens
House in Lyndhurst. The headquarters of the Forestry
Commission, the body that handles the maintenance of the
softwood plantations, forest roads and paths, and
controlling the spread of invasive plants, such as
Rhododendrons and Gorse is based in Queen's House in the
Village.
